    Abstract: A fixing apparatus includes a heating roller, a fixing roller, a fixing belt that is wound around the heating roller and the fixing roller and circulates between the heating roller and the fixing roller, a pressing roller to press the fixing roller through the fixing belt, a first heater that is included in the heating roller and mainly heats a center part of the heating roller, a second heater that is included in the heating roller and mainly heats a peripheral part of the heating roller, and a temperature control unit to control a temperature of the heating roller by an on/off control of the first heater and the second heater, and the temperature control unit performs the on/off control in which when one of the first heater and the second heater is turned on, the other is turned off.

    Abstract: A fixing roller/fixing belt having an elastic layer and a surface layer formed on a substrate material in the enumerated order, wherein the surface layer is a layer formed by thermally shrinking a PFA tube, and the surface layer and the elastic layer are bonded together through a PFA-containing adhesive material. In particular, a fixing roller/fixing belt in which the ratio of heat shrinkage of the PFA tube forming the surface layer is 3 to 20%. Also, a fixing roller/fixing belt, in which the quantity of PFA contained in the PFA-containing adhesive material is 20 to 30 wt %.

    Abstract: A fixing device includes a fixing roller and a pressure roller. The fixing roller and the pressure roller each have an elastic layer formed between a core bar and a release layer, which release layer serves as a surface of the fixing roller and the pressure roller. The pressure roller has a lower Asker-C hardness than that of the fixing roller, and has a greater micro rubber hardness than that of the fixing roller. This prevents the surface of the pressure roller from deteriorating in a short period of time.

    Abstract: A heating roller performs electromagnetic induction heating, and includes a first exciting coil that heats the heating roller, a first degaussing coil that decreases magnetic fields of the first exciting coil, and a first axial direction core that guides magnetic fluxes, to make up a magnetic circuit between the first axial direction core and the heating roller. The width of a heat zone is controlled in agreement with a sheet feeding area. Thus, the capability to control a temperature increase in a non-sheet-feeding area of the heating roller is enhanced. Power can be saved during continual feeding of small recording sheets.

    Abstract: A fixing device includes a fixing roller, a pressure roller and a soaking roller. Temperature of the soaking roller, which contacts with the pressure roller, is measured by a temperature measurement section. This makes it possible to precisely estimate the temperature distribution of the fixing roller and the pressure roller including a non-paper feed area of paper sheets. Based on the temperature of the soaking roller, fixing operation is controlled by a fixing operation control section. Thereby, optimal control can be implemented to suppress the temperature rise in the non-paper feed area according to the estimated temperature distribution of the fixing roller and the pressure roller.

    Abstract: A fixing device includes a fixing belt for fixing an unfixed toner image onto a recording medium, a planar heating member for heating the fixing belt, and a pressure roller. The heating member includes a ceramic heat generating element having a PTC characteristic, and a high-thermal-conductive heat diffusion member. The fixing belt is formed in an endless shape and is supported around, at least, the high-thermal-conductive heat diffusion member, thereby to be heated. The ceramic heat generating element comes into contact with the fixing belt over the full width thereof with the high-thermal-conductive heat diffusion member interposed therebetween. The high-thermal-conductive heat diffusion member comes into contact with the fixing belt over the full width thereof and diffuses heat generated by the heat generating element, in the traveling direction of the fixing belt.
